Output d53d6649bf6635e30392011114b3c1540f9803de5d7ae3825b0effbb2b0ec2c9:1

value
10900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33c8c5a7e3c173de3b916d125f9989f9e510a153 OP_EQUAL
address
36QpuDXC47pDgU7k6U49MLunLXL99CyheP
transaction
d53d6649bf6635e30392011114b3c1540f9803de5d7ae3825b0effbb2b0ec2c9
spent
true